Health Utilities Index Mark 3
Abstract
BACKGROUND: The Health Utilities Index Mark 3 (HUI3) is a comprehensive, compact health status classification and health state preference system. The HUI3 system has been included in 4 Canadian population health surveys and numerous clinical trials.
OBJECTIVES: To evaluate the construct validity of the HUI3 for the measurement of health-related quality of life (HRQL) and attribute-specific morbidity in respondents to the 1990 Ontario Health …
